A vulnerability has been reported in Gnumeric, which can be exploited by
malicious people to compromise a user's system.

The vulnerability is caused due to integer overflows and signedness errors when
processing XLS HLINK opcodes within the "excel_read_HLINK()" function in
plugins/excel/ms-excel-read.c. This can be exploited to corrupt the stack via a
specially crafted XLS file.

Successful exploitation allows execution of arbitrary code.

The vulnerability is confirmed in version 1.6.3. Versions prior to 1.8.1 may
also be affected.

Solution:
Update to version 1.8.1.
